I've been searching but haven't seen a specific topic on this (please link me to it if there is one already. But, I'm trying to freeze a VI track and my issue is this:
When freezing the VI it freezes the selection range of the corresponding MIDI notes, however, I would like to extend the freeze to the end of the measure, not just the end of the last MIDI note. What I have been doing (which is a bit tedious) is manually copying an extra note to the start of the 1st measure AFTER the range I've selected so DP is forced to freeze partly into say the 5th measure if I'm only trying to freeze 4 measures of VI. Am I missing something, or is there away to tell DP to freeze until the end of the 4 measures instead of the last MIDI note?
This comes into play because there are effects, echoes, delays, etc. that continue after the last MIDI note is released that I would like to have as part of the freeze. Simply holding the MIDI note out to the end of the measure does not solve this because it may add or maintain additional sounds/notes to the end of the range that I don't actually want.
It's not so much an issue with one track, but I find myself having to do this with multiple tracks in a particular project very often.

I've discussed this elsewhere, but I always just select a empty measure or two extra at the end of a MIDI track in the Tracks window with the cursor when selecting the MIDI track(s) I want to freeze or bounce, for the exact purpose of having enough space for reverb tails, instrument tails and delays beyond the end of the track's MIDI information. It will bounce or freeze to the end of your highlighted selection, regardless of whether there's any actual information in it or not.
